Ethiopia’s Public-Private Partnerships Directorate General within the Ministry of Finance issued an RFQ for four renewable Scaling Solar Round II energy projects auction program. The four Utility-Scale Photovoltaic (PV) Project will be developed in areas of Weranso, Welencheti, Humera and Mekelle.

The RFQ round will pre-qualify prospective bidders with the requisite experience, expertise, and financial resources to rapidly deliver the solar PV PPP Projects. Then the next stage will involve a Request for Proposals (RFP) from pre-qualified bidders.

The deadline to submit the RFQ is May 29, 2019.
